Bremer Whyte Brown & O'Meara, LLP is seeking a Litigation Attorney to join our award-winning team. The attorney will handle a diverse caseload including commercial, contract/business disputes, general liability, construction, catastrophic injury, and wrongful death claims, with the opportunity for mentorship from experienced partners.
The ideal candidate has a JD, at least 3+ years of civil litigation experience, and a California Bar admission.
